Struppi is a young herdschutzhund-mixed breed with a huge heart—and at least as much nonsense in his head. The typical herdschutzhund character shines through—he is independent, likes to make his own decisions, and clearly shows when he doesn’t want something. He likes to test boundaries, can also jump on people in overexcitement, and has hardly any basic obedience training. On the leash, he already runs well, but training, patience, and ideally a visit to dog training classes are still needed. Struppi is often like a charming tramp: full of energy, friendly, but also sometimes wild. With other dogs, he is basically compatible, but especially in the first contact, he shows himself stormy and needs clear guidance to orient himself. What Struppi is looking for: We wish for Struppi people with experience in dealing with large, independent dogs—ideally with knowledge of herdschutzhunds. Sensitive but consistent guidance, clear boundaries, and patience are important. A house with a securely fenced garden would be perfect, so he has space to think, guard, and play. What Struppi offers: • A loyal companion with humor, character, and much personality • A dog who loves his people when trust is built up • A raw diamond with a herdschutzhund soul that will become a unique family member with time, guidance, and love. If you enjoy strong characters, fur, and a whole lot of heart—Struppi could be your perfect dog.

🇩🇪Adopting from Germany

German rescues typically require an in-person home visit (Vorkontrolle) or detailed video home check before approving adoption. Animals leave the shelter sterilized, microchipped, and with a valid EU pet passport. Adoption fees usually fall between €250 and €450, covering veterinary preparation.

Can I adopt Struppi Großer Quatschkopf mit Herz sucht standfestes Zuhause if I live in another country?
Yes, in most cases. Rescues across Europe routinely place animals abroad — HundeHilfe Koblenz e.V. will tell you what they need (EU pet passport, rabies titer, transport coordination) and whether they handle transport themselves or refer you to a partner. Plan for an extra €100–€350 in transport costs depending on distance.
